Man falls from apartment building, hitting and killing female pedestrian in Nagoya
A man fell or jumped from a 12-story apartment building in Nagoya, tragically striking and killing a 23-year-old female pedestrian below. The man is in serious condition, while the woman died from hemorrhagic shock.
